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ets
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
Federal Tax Bracket | Federal Tax Rates |
---|---|
$57,375.00 or less | 14.5% |
$57,375.00 - $114,749.99 | 20.5% |
$114,750.00 - $177,881.99 | 26% |
$177,882.00 - $253,413.99 | 29% |
More than $253,414.00 | 33% |
Alberta Tax Bracket | Alberta Tax Rates |
---|---|
$151,234.00 or less | 6% |
$151,234.00 - $181,480.99 | 12% |
$181,481.00 - $241,973.99 | 13% |
$241,974.00 - $362,960.99 | 14% |
More than $362,961.00 | 15% |

Region | Total Income | Total Deductions | Net Pay | Avg. Tax Rate | Comp. Deduction Rate |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Nunavut | $69,500.00 | $15,479.57 | $54,020.43 | 14.5% | 22.27% |
Alberta | $69,500.00 | $15,770.26 | $53,729.74 | 14.92% | 22.69% |
British Columbia | $69,500.00 | $16,376.62 | $53,123.38 | 15.79% | 23.56% |
Northwest Territories | $69,500.00 | $16,465.31 | $53,034.69 | 15.92% | 23.69% |
Yukon | $69,500.00 | $16,558.86 | $52,941.14 | 16.06% | 23.83% |
Ontario | $69,500.00 | $17,128.44 | $52,371.56 | 16.87% | 24.65% |
Saskatchewan | $69,500.00 | $18,263.58 | $51,236.42 | 18.51% | 26.28% |
New Brunswick | $69,500.00 | $18,902.71 | $50,597.29 | 19.43% | 27.2% |
Manitoba | $69,500.00 | $18,940.71 | $50,559.29 | 19.48% | 27.25% |
Newfoundland and Labrador | $69,500.00 | $19,374.01 | $50,125.99 | 20.11% | 27.88% |
Prince Edward Island | $69,500.00 | $19,547.83 | $49,952.17 | 20.36% | 28.13% |
Quebec | $69,500.00 | $19,771.36 | $49,728.64 | 20.07% | 28.45% |
Nova Scotia | $69,500.00 | $20,442.78 | $49,057.22 | 21.64% | 29.41% |
